Common Failures of GEELY 5052019900C15 Rear spoiler for Emgrand
- Spoiler Loosening: In Emgrand models with OE number 5052019900C15, the rear spoiler may become loose due to long - term vibration.
- Paint Peeling: The paint on the rear spoiler of Emgrand can peel off, especially in areas with harsh weather conditions.
- Crack Formation: Some Emgrand owners have found cracks on the rear spoiler 5052019900C15 after minor impacts.
Maintenance Tips of GEELY 5052019900C15 Rear spoiler for Emgrand
- Before installing the GEELY Emgrand rear spoiler (OE# 5052019900C15), ensure the car body is clean and free of dirt and grease. This will provide a better bonding surface.
- Use the right tools, such as a torque wrench, to tighten the spoiler bolts. Follow the specified torque value to prevent over - or under - tightening.
- Check the alignment of the rear spoiler with the Emgrand's body lines. Proper alignment not only enhances appearance but also ensures aerodynamic performance.
- Verify the quality of the spoiler. A genuine GEELY rear spoiler is made of high - quality materials and should match the car's paint color well.
- Test the spoiler's stability after installation. Give it a gentle shake to make sure it's firmly attached.
Warning: When installing the GEELY Emgrand rear spoiler (OE# 5052019900C15), avoid overtightening the bolts as it may damage the car body or the spoiler itself.
